About Xinyi Liu

Xinyi Liu is a scholar working on Filtration and Separation, Mechanical Engineering and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, having authored 103 papers that have together received 2.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Battery Materials and Technologies (20 papers), Advancements in Battery Materials (18 papers), Catalysis and Hydrodesulfurization Studies (15 papers), Perovskite Materials and Applications (11 papers),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(10 papers), Nanomaterials for catalytic reactions (9 papers), Advanced battery technologies research (8 papers) and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Infectious Diseases (337 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(479 citations) and Materials Chemistry (636 citations). Xinyi Liu has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Hong Kong. Frequent co-authors include Cui Li, Zhiheng Xu, Shuai Hong, Lei Shi, Yisheng Jiang, Nana Zhang, Qing Ye, Cheng‐Feng Qin, Dan Xu and Cen Zhang.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Advanced Materials and Angewandte Chemie International Edition.
